Fix style: white space in lambdas.
Fix style: white space in multi-line lists.
Fix style: white space in exports and imports.
Test removing spaces around lines.
Allow empty lines when hard line breaking.
Properly use ICU locale identifiers.
Allow breaking at character bounds.
Move non-public modules into Internal namespace.
Use ICU to find line break boundaries.